Video: The weather forecast for North East Lincolnshire read by Ormiston South Parade Academy pupils
OUR Forecast Friends were hoping to start building their snowmen this week, but have been sadly disappointed.
As reported, every week, we get children from a local school to read the weather and put the video on www.thisisgrimsby.co.uk.
-

Outlook: Students from Ormiston South Parade Academy with the weather forcaset for this week. From left, Jordan Blow, 11, Tyler-George Prest, 9, Mica Forrester, 9, Callum Boarder, 10 and Megan Hutson, 9.
This week, a handful of eager forecasters from Ormiston South Parade Academy did the honours.
Most of them were hoping to wake up and see the ground covered with snow, but with temperatures expected to reach nine degrees at some point this week, it’s not looking likely.

Callum Boarder, 10, said he will now continue to check the weather so he knows what to wear.
He said: “I really enjoyed making the video and suggesting what I would like the weather to be.”
Jordan Blow, 11, said: “I enjoyed the opportunity to show off our school in a unique way.”
